what you will love… modern | luxury | entertaining Positioned at the end of this tightly held cul-de-sac and displaying immense curb side appeal, this private and spacious home offers a rare opportunity for family living with a focus on entertaining in the sleepy beachside suburb of Towradgi. Its interior and exterior living areas are seamless in design offering growing families room to grow and the perfect balance of style and comfort. + meticulously maintained with multiple casual and formal living zones + 'consulting room' with separate access ideal for home businesses + amazing indoor/outdoor entertaining spaces connecting the home + gas-heated, salt water self-cleaning pool with travertine tiles + no rear neighbors with green belt reserve to the rear of the home + energy efficient 7.6kw solar power system with solar hot water + outdoor kitchen with bbq and Ziegler & brown grand turbo rangehood + kitchen with stainless steel appliances, walk-in pantry, and stone benches + four bedrooms all with built-ins, main with his and hers walk-in-robes + ducted zoned heating/cooling throughout all bedrooms and living + 12-minute walk to Towradgi Beach, 8-minute drive to Wollongong CBD + council = $2,551 pa, water = $688 pa, land size = 677 sqm m + m = :) Whilst every effort has been made to ensure the accuracy and thoroughness of the information provided to you in our marketing material, we cannot guarantee the accuracy of the information provided by our vendors, and as such, molenaar + mcneice makes no statement, representation or warranty, and assumes no legal liability in relation to the accuracy of the information provided.
